Default Sea.Bar.Is

Used this place for drinks on several occasions. Great atmosphere and always busy.

Splendid addition to that end of the front and long may it continue.

Personal choice I realise ,but they always seemed to have a good selection of music playing.

Not much from my era, but then how many places would still have a gramophone with a horn and dog emblem on it.
